With just two inspections in the record, there isn't enough history to establish a clear pattern. On Apr 8, 2025, the health department conducted the most recent visit. Medium risk typically reflects a handful of issues that inspectors wrote up but didn't deem critical.

Compared to the prior visit, the count dropped from five violations to three.

The pattern that stands out is hot TCS food item not held at or above 140 °F, which has been cited two times.

The city-wide average sits at 75, which Dragon King's 64 doesn't quite reach. The full record sits in fairly typical territory for a working restaurant.
